Ni-Mo-Mg CATALYTIC CARBONIZATION TO ACHIEVING HIGH FLAME RETARDANCY OF LLDPE
A kind of Ni-Mo-Mg catalysts (Nmm-cats) was demonstrated to catalyze effectively the carbonization of linear low-density polyethylene (LLDPE) and significantly improve its flame retardancy.A charring experiment testified that the Nmm-cats with appropriate Mo/Mg/Ni mole ratio value could deposit nearly 56 wt% of volatile products from LLDPE with the Nmm-cat mass fraction as low as 5%.The improvement in the flammability retardancy of LLDPE was clarified by using a cone calorimeter.
